USSR SHOP »
Магазин » 4 - Лабораторная работа по ООП
Купить 4 - Лабораторная работа по ООП
Описание товара:
Язык программирования: С++
Среда разработки: Visual Studio 2010 - Консольное приложение
Тема: Преобразование типов. Дружественные функции. Конструктор копирования
Задание: Задание 1
Определить два класса, строку с преобразованием из char * в строку и обратно и Целое Int с преобразованием из int и обратно, а также взаимное преобразование String и Int.
Задание 2
Создать класс целых чисел Integer. Определить перегруженную функцию, возвращающую максимальное из двух аргументов. Функция не является членом класса целых чисел. Перегруженные функции имеют аргументы типа int, double, Integer. Тело перегруженных функций должны быть одинаковыми.
Задание 3
Создать два класса вектор (long *) и матрица (long **). Определить конструкторы - по умолчанию, с параметром, для класса матрица с двумя параметрами, копирования, деструкторы. Определить функцию умножения матрицу на вектор.
Среда разработки: Visual Studio 2010 - Консольное приложение
Тема: Преобразование типов. Дружественные функции. Конструктор копирования
Задание: Задание 1
Определить два класса, строку с преобразованием из char * в строку и обратно и Целое Int с преобразованием из int и обратно, а также взаимное преобразование String и Int.
Задание 2
Создать класс целых чисел Integer. Определить перегруженную функцию, возвращающую максимальное из двух аргументов. Функция не является членом класса целых чисел. Перегруженные функции имеют аргументы типа int, double, Integer. Тело перегруженных функций должны быть одинаковыми.
Задание 3
Создать два класса вектор (long *) и матрица (long **). Определить конструкторы - по умолчанию, с параметром, для класса матрица с двумя параметрами, копирования, деструкторы. Определить функцию умножения матрицу на вектор.